Gigster Network - Senior iOS Developer (choose your own pay rate)

Remote /
Gigster /
Contractor
Do you want to work on cutting-edge projects with the world’s best developers? Do you wish you could control which projects to work on and choose your own pay rate? Are you interested in the future of work and how the cloud will form teams? If so - the Gigster Talent Network is for you.

The Senior iOS Developer position is a critical role in the teams we form for important US clients such as IBM, US Bank, Harley Davidson, Colgate, Dapper and 500 others. In this role, you will own the entire iOS experience - from technical leadership to UI/UX to integrating the latest technology with the backend components. The tech stack will vary with the projects - but range from Objective-C or Swift etc. 

Responsibilities

    • Design and build advanced applications for the iOS platform.                                                                                      
    • Lead the design and development of innovative solutions to both technical and business problems.
    • Participate in code reviews, write automated tests, and help define the technical roadmap.                                                                                       
    • Collaborate with the team to define, design, and ship new features. 

Requirements

    • 8+ years of experience working in software engineering in a professional setting. 4+ years of experience in iOS development.
    • Proficient with Objective-C or Swift
    • Experience with iOS frameworks such as Core Data, Core Animation, etc.
    • Experience with offline storage, threading, and performance tuning
    • Familiarity with RESTful APIs to connect iOS applications to back-end services
    • Knowledge of other web technologies and UI/UX standards
    • Understanding of Apple’s design principles and interface guidelines
    • Knowledge of low-level C-based libraries is preferred
    • Experience with performance and memory tuning with tools {{such as Instruments and Shark, depending on project needs}}
    • Familiarity with cloud message APIs and push notifications
    • Knack for benchmarking and optimization
    • Proficient understanding of code versioning tools {{such as Git, Mercurial or SVN}}
    • Familiarity with continuous integration
    • Experience with Agile development methodologies
    • Experience with responsive designs
    • Proficiency with Git/Github or other distributed version control systems
    • Proven success in contributing in a team-oriented and fast-paced environment
    • Excellent communications (written and oral) and interpersonal skills
About the Gigster Talent Network & why this role is for you

The Gigster Talent Network is a highly curated set of the best software developers in the world. It’s not easy to become part of this select network - but when you do - you will work amongst the best from Silicon Valley and around the world.

Our model is unique in the software development industry. We do the hard work of finding the US clients and scoping their projects - and you get to choose from a large variety of ‘Gigs’. You can choose Gigs that fit your schedule - from 10, 20 or 40 hours a week. You also get to choose your own pay rate. All projects are staffed with a project manager, full stack team, QA and DevOps.

All of our projects are for top tier US companies and delivered with the highest quality. Projects range from developing NFT marketplaces to VR imaging for medical use to large AI/ML projects. We even produce a case study for every project delivered - so you can take that with you as part of your portfolio.

In parallel - you will have access to an exclusive and energized network of the world’s most skilled experts. Community members collaborate inside and outside of Gigs - as well as at local community events, online hackathons and competitions, etc. The Gigster Talent Network is more than a simple marketplace - it’s truly an exclusive club.

Are you talented enough to be in the club?